How to become a thane and buy a house in Whiterun

House of warm winds (Breezehome)

  • Location: Whiterun;
  • Base cost: 5000 gold;
  • The cost of a fully equipped house: 6800 gold.

A small house near the city gates. To get the house, complete the quest "Bleak Falls Barrow" at the request of Jarl Balgruuf to become the Thane of Whiterun, or buy the house from Brill after completing the quest "Battle of Whiterun" (Battle for Whiterun) for either side conflict.

Furnishings for the home can be bought from Proventus Avenicci, who can usually be found in Dragonsreach. The following upgrades are available for purchase: living room (250 gold), kitchen (300 gold), dining room (250 gold), second floor living room (200 gold), bedroom (300 gold) and alchemy laboratory (500 gold).

How to become a thane and buy a house in Markarth

Vlindrel Hall

  • Location: Markarth;
  • The cost of a fully equipped house: 12200 gold.

To buy this house, help Jarl Igmund - complete the tasks "Kill the Forsworn Leader (Jarl)", "Find Hrolfdir's Shield" and help any 5 inhabitants of Markarth. For this, Jarl Igmund will name you Thane of Markarth and allow you to settle in the city.

After fully upgrading the house, the house will have: a bedroom (800 gold), a living room (900 gold), an alchemy laboratory (1000 gold), an enchanter's altar (1000 gold) and an entrance hall (500 gold).

How to become a thane and buy a house in Riften

Honey cake (Honeyside)

  • Location: Riften;
  • Base cost: 8000 gold;
  • The cost of a fully equipped house: 12300 gold.

You will be able to buy this house after completing The Raid and helping any 3 residents of Riften. After that, Jarl Laila the Hand of the Law (Laila Law-Giver) will call Dovahkin tan of Riften and will allow you to purchase a house.

After all the upgrades, you will have a nice house with a porch (400 gold), a kitchen (500 gold), a bedroom (600 gold), a garden (800 gold), an enchanter's altar (1000 gold), an alchemy laboratory (1000 gold) and a nursery (550 gold).

How to become a thane and buy a house in Windhelm

Hjerim

  • Location: Windhelm;
  • Base cost: 12,000 gold;
  • Cost of a fully equipped house: 21,000 gold.

You may remember this house from the Blood on the Ice quest. In order to purchase this house, you need to earn the title of Thane of Eastmarsh by completing the quest mentioned above, as well as complete the storyline of the Empire or the Stormcloaks. Only then does the player's character become Windhelm's thane and can purchase Hjerim.

The house can be upgraded with the following furnishings: Alchemy Lab (1500 gold), Living Room (1500 gold), Nursery (1250 gold), Kitchen Furniture (1000 gold), Enchanter's Laboratory (1500 gold), Bedroom Furniture (1000 gold), and Armory ( 2000).

If you do not want to see the traces of murders left after the passage of "Blood in the Snow", you can pay for the services of a cleaner (500 gold).

How to Become a Thane and Buy a House in Solitude

High Spire (Proudspire Manor)

  • Location: Solitude;
  • Base cost: 25,000 gold;
  • The cost of a fully equipped house: 36,000 gold.

This is the most expensive house in Skyrim. In order to buy it, you need to complete The Man Who Cried Wolf and Elisif's Tribute quests, as well as help 5 residents of Solitude. This is the only way to become the Thane of Solitude and get the opportunity to buy the High Spire - a house consisting of 3 floors and 6 rooms.

The house is very large, almost every room can be improved. Here are the furnishing items available for the High Spire: 1st floor living room (2000gp), 2nd floor living room (2000gp), kitchen (1500gp), bedroom (2000gp), bedroom (2000gp), enchanter's altar (2500gp). ), an alchemy laboratory (2500 gold) and a portico (500 gold).

Gives a quest: Wujit
Requirement: completed quest Cure Wujita
Reward: Random enchanted item based on level.

The quest can be accepted after completing the quest Cure Wujita from the Argonian Wujit in Riften.



We ask her where she takes skooma. Vujita is afraid to tell us, but after persuasion or a bribe, she agrees to answer us. We learn that Skooma is taken from Sartis Idren, who keeps it in a locked cache of the Riften warehouse, and the jarl has the key to the warehouse. We go to the jarl of riften and find out that she knows everything about it, but they cannot catch this merchant.



We offer our help and get the key to the warehouse to catch the poison dealer.

We penetrate the warehouse of Riften using the key and kill Sartis Idren and his bodyguard.



Then we return with a note to Jarl. We tell her that Sartis has been killed and she will ask us to deal with his accomplices and for this she will make it possible to get closer to obtaining the title in Riften. And we learn that they can be found in the Cregslane cave.



We go to the place and kill everyone without exception (if you have already been in the cave before the start of the quest and killed everyone, then it will not be possible to continue the quest).

After the murder, we return to the jarl and report that the skooma warehouse in the Kregslane cave is finished, for which she will give a gift (it may vary depending on the player's level).

Conditions for obtaining a title
The title can be obtained in the following holdings:
  • Winterhold
  • Whiterun
  • Riften
  • Limit (Markarth)
  • White Coast (Dunstar)
  • Hjaalmarch (Morthal)
  • Haafingare (Solitude)
  • Falkreath
  • Eastmarch (Windhelm)

To get the title, you need to complete tasks from the townspeople, or from the jarl and the steward. Let me remind you that they can be found in the throne room of the palace, or in the large houses of the jarl.
In Whiterun, you get the title at the beginning of the main storyline.
In cities where you can buy a house (Riften, Markarth, Solitude and Windhelm), the title of than is given only after buying this very house. The Jarl will then give you an assignment to help a certain number of the city's inhabitants, and then reward you with this honorary title.
In smaller towns (Winterhold, Dawnstar, Morthal and Falkreath), the title is given simply for helping the townspeople.
What kind of tasks need to be done? It's impossible to say for sure. Due to the Radiant Story, you may have completely different tasks from the Miscellaneous section. Just go around all the characters and you will surely find plenty of tasks from them. In addition, tasks are issued in batches. We collected and completed one batch - you can walk around the city again, and the characters will have new assignments.

Conditions for obtaining the title of thane in The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im (Legendary Edition):

  • Whiterun/ Whiterun (Huscarl: Lydia; Property: House of Warm Winds):
    • Complete the story quest "Wind Peak" and deliver the Dragonstone to Faringar's court mage.
    • Kill the dragon Milmurnir at the Western Watchtower in the "Dragon in the Sky" main mission.
  • Falkreath/ Falkreath (Huscarl: Raya; Property: Ozernoe Estate):
    • Develop your character to level 9 and wait for a courier with a letter from the jarl, who will invite you to complete the task of killing the leader of the robbers in the Bile Mine (or any other random location).
    • At the request of Thadgeir, who is chopping wood at the Dead Man's Honey tavern, take the ashes of Berith to the priest of Arkay Runil in the Hall of the Dead at the request of Thadgeir.
    • Talk to Mathieu about his daughter, who was killed by Sinding, thrown into the Falkreath prison, and complete the "Call of the Moon" quest.
    • Speak with Priest Runil of Arkay in the Hall of the Dead and complete a side quest to recover a lost diary, such as from the Divided Gorge (or any other random location).
    • Talk to the former Jarl of Falkreath, Dengeir Stunsky, who appears in the Dead Man's Honey tavern during the day and returns home at night, and complete his assignment to steal a letter from the house of the blacksmith Lod. At level 12 of character development, another task appears to kill the vampire Vikhar from the Bloody Throne tower, southeast of Falkreath.
